Web Design A Beginner’s Guide
Web design is an exciting and creative career that allows you to build websites and shape how people interact with the internet. If you are completely new to web design, don’t worry! This guide will take you through the basic steps in the simplest way possible.
Step 1: Understand What Web Design Is
Web design is the process of creating the layout, look, and feel of a website. It involves using colors, images, fonts, and navigation to make a website attractive and easy to use. A web designer focuses on the visual aspect, while web developers handle the coding behind the scenes.
Step 2: Learn the Basics of HTML and CSS
HTML (HyperText Markup Language) and CSS (Cascading Style Sheets) are the building blocks of web design.
- HTML is used to structure the content on a webpage (like text, images, and buttons).
- CSS is used to style the webpage (like colors, fonts, and layouts). You can start learning these for free on platforms like W3Schools, freeCodeCamp, or MDN Web Docs.
Step 3: Get Familiar with Design Principles
A good web designer understands design principles such as:
- Layout – Organizing elements so the page looks clean and professional.
- Color Theory – Using colors that complement each other and create the right mood.
- Typography – Choosing readable and attractive fonts.
- User Experience (UX) – Making sure visitors can navigate the site easily.
Step 4: Use Website Builders or Design Software
Before learning advanced coding, you can use website builders like WordPress, Wix, or Elementor to practice designing websites without coding. You can also use design tools like Adobe XD, Figma, or Canva to create mockups (visual plans) before building a website.
Step 5: Learn Responsive Design
Websites need to look good on all devices (desktops, tablets, and phones). Responsive design ensures that a website automatically adjusts to fit different screen sizes. Learn how to use CSS Flexbox and Grid to create responsive layouts.
Step 6: Practice by Creating Sample Projects
The best way to learn is by doing. Start by designing small projects like:
- A personal portfolio website
- A simple business landing page
- A blog layout You can look at existing websites for inspiration and try to recreate them.
Step 7: Learn Basic JavaScript (Optional but Helpful)
JavaScript adds interactivity to websites, like animations, pop-ups, and dynamic content. While not required for beginners, learning a little JavaScript can make your designs more functional.
Step 8: Build a Portfolio
A portfolio is a collection of your best designs and projects. Create a simple website showcasing your skills and previous work. This will help you attract clients or get a job as a web designer.
Step 9: Keep Learning and Stay Updated
Web design trends change over time. Follow blogs, watch tutorials, and practice regularly to stay up to date with new techniques and tools.
Step 10: Start Freelancing or Look for Jobs
Once you have some experience, you can offer web design services as a freelancer on platforms like Fiverr, Upwork, or Freelancer. Alternatively, you can apply for jobs as a junior web designer in companies.
Conclusion
Becoming a web designer is an exciting journey that anyone can start, even without prior knowledge. By learning HTML, CSS, and design principles and practicing through real projects, you can develop the skills needed to create stunning websites. Start today, and with time and dedication, you’ll become a skilled web designer!